This simple handheld spirometer features a high performance Fleisch flow measuring technology and displays key spirometry parameters. It also enables spirometry reports to be printed from your PC.
Features and Benefits
- Single breath evaluation of FVC, FEV1, FEV1% and PEF
- Complete with Vitalograph Reports PC software creating PDF reports
- Report includes f/v and v/t curves with test quality, predicted values and interpretation
- Parameters FVC, FEV1, FEV1%, PEF, FEV6, PEF, FEF25, FEF50, FEF75, FEF25-75
- Tested and certified to ATS/ERS:2005 spirometry guidelines
- Uses standard size SafeTway disposable mouthpieces for assured hygiene
- Fleisch technology flow sensor gives low back pressure
- High visibility liquid crystal display with large numerals and icons

Technical Specifications
- Parameters Displayed: FVC, FEV1, FEV1%, PEF
- Parameters on Report: FVC, FEV1, FEV1%, PEF, FEV6, PEF, FEF25, FEF50, FEF75, FEF25-75 (PDF report)
- Operating Temperature Range:
- ATS/ERS Limits: 17 - 37 °C
- Design Limits: 10 - 40 °C
- Battery:
- User-Replaceable PP3
- 400 Tests Operating Life
- Auto shutdown 2 Minutes After Last Key Press
- Measuring Principle: Solid State NO2 Fleisch pneumotachograph
- Accuracy: Better than +/-3% volumes
- Range: 0 - 9.99 L BTPS
- Flow Impedance: Better than 0.15 kPa/L/s at 14 L/s
- Display: Reflective LCD
- Size: 145 x 70 x 40mm
- Weight: 165g
- Performance Standards:
- ISO EN 23747:2005
- ATS/ERS:2005 Guidelines
- Safety Standards: EN ISO 60601-1:2005 -1 -2 -4
- Medical Safety Standard: Medical Devices Directive
- Designed & Manufactured Under:ISO 13485:2003, FDA 21CFR820, CMDR & JPAL
- Communications: USB
